Severe cyber attack on WebTPA exposes sensitive data of millions of users

The incident puts the privacy and security of millions of people, including customers and business partners, at risk

A data breach hit WebTPA, exposing the personal information of 2.4 million people. The company is working to resolve the issue and offers credit monitoring services. Victims should check their finances and update passwords for safety.

A recent data breach affected WebTPA, a third-party administration services provider, exposing the personal information of approximately 2.4 million individuals. The incident was confirmed by the company itself which informed the parties involved through official press releases and individual notifications. The compromised information includes sensitive details such as names, addresses, dates of birth and health insurance information, raising significant privacy and security concerns for those affected.

Ongoing investigation and corrective actions

WebTPA is cooperating with the relevant authorities and has launched an internal investigation to determine the extent of the incident and identify vulnerabilities exploited by the attackers. The company has also taken immediate measures to strengthen data protection and prevent further unauthorized access. The actions undertaken include the improvement of security systems and the implementation of new protocols for monitoring suspicious activities. This timely response aims to restore customer trust and limit the potential damage resulting from the breach.

Severe impact on customers and partners

The data breach had a significant impact not only on WebTPA's customers but also on their business partners. Insurance providers and medical companies that rely on WebTPA to manage their health plans are now facing increased risks related to identity theft and scams. The legal and financial implications for these organizations could be substantial, requiring additional resources to manage consequences and protect data subjects.

Advice for data breach victims

Individuals affected by the data breach are urged to carefully monitor their financial statements and credit reports to quickly identify suspicious activity. WebTPA is offering free credit monitoring and identity protection services to help individuals protect themselves from potential fraud. Additionally, it is recommended that you update your passwords and enable two-factor authentication on your online accounts. These steps can help mitigate the risks of personal information leaks and ensure greater security in the long term.
